Abstract

Organic Computing Systems feature self-organization techniques to manage complex distributed systems. This paper proposes an implementation of self-x techniques in an organic middleware. We extend a middleware by an Organic Manager that is based on an automated planner. The Organic Manager unites self-x features which were formerly implemented separately.
